11. Conclusion

Whatever the circumstances of their adoptions, adopted children need nurturing relationships with adoptive families who can help them manage feelings of loss and grief—and help them heal. They also need an ongoing mix of services and supports from community providers that are family centered, nonjudgmental, culturally sensitive, and "adoption-competent" (i.e., providers who understand and are able to address the long-term impact of trauma on adopted children). By providing postadoption services, professionals are able to support families and to maintain safety, permanency, and well-being for children.
